Content descriptions

General Note:
Prequel to: The Blue Sword.
Summary, etc.:
Aerin, with the guidance of the wizard Luthe and the help of the Blue Sword, wins the birthright due her as the daughter of the Damarian king and a witchwoman of the mysterious, demon-haunted North.
